我正在尝试将FB注释框放在我网站上每个产品页面的底部。我已设法做到这一点,但当设置为静态URL时,它会对每个产品说出相同的评论。我删除了网址,现在它有点工作,但说插件处于兼容模式。
我的产品模板中有什么内容:
我的网站是trickscooter.co.uk所以你可以看到。评论框位于每个产品的底部。
我希望人们能够对所显示的项目提出问题,以便我可以回答这些问题,以便所有人都能看到。
PS - 它说:
警告:此评论插件在兼容模式下运行,但尚无帖子。请考虑在comments插件文档中指定一个显式的'href',以利用所有插件功能。
谢谢!
答案 0 :(得分:0)
静态URL不会对'href'参数执行,因为该参数告诉Facebook要显示哪些注释。如果您始终使用相同的URL,当然您会得到相同的评论。每个产品都应该有一个唯一的URL并动态使用它。
如果您动态生成href参数,则需要注意,如果您的页面可以在不同的域下访问,则会丢失注释。
最好的方法是配置'facebook domain'(例如'www.foo.example')并使用它来生成Facebook评论的href属性。
如果我误解了您,请解释您当前的嵌入代码以及您尝试过的内容。如果您喜欢这个答案,请将其标记为“解决方案”。